谷歌浏览器的开发者模式详解
谷歌浏览器(Google Chrome)以其速度和简洁的用户界面而受到广大用户的喜爱,但除了基本的浏览功能外,它还提供了强大的开发者工具,使得开发者可以更便捷地调试和优化网页。在这篇文章中,我们将深入探讨谷歌浏览器的开发者模式,帮助开发者更好地利用这一功能。
一、打开开发者工具
在谷歌浏览器中,打开开发者工具的方法非常简单。用户可以通过右键点击网页的任意位置,选择“检查”或直接使用快捷键F12(Windows)或Cmd+Opt+I(Mac)打开开发者工具。一旦打开,用户将看到一个包含多个标签页的面板,其主要组成部分包括元素面板、控制台、源代码、网络、性能、安全性等。
二、元素面板
元素面板是开发者工具最常用的部分之一。在这里,用户可以查看和修改当前网页的DOM结构和CSS样式。通过选择特定的HTML元素,用户可以实时修改它的样式属性,观察更改对页面显示的实际影响。这对于调试网页布局和样式设计非常方便。
三、控制台
控制台面板是开发者与网站交互的重要窗口。开发者可以在此查看JavaScript的日志和报错信息,同时也可以输入JavaScript代码进行快速测试。控制台支持各种命令,可以帮助开发者了解代码的执行状态和调试应用程序逻辑。
四、源代码
源代码面板显示了网页的JavaScript和其他资源文件。在此,开发者可以查看具体的代码实现,设置断点以调试JavaScript文件。这对于排查代码问题和分析性能瓶颈非常有帮助。此外,开发者还可以利用此面板进行代码覆盖分析,以便找出没有被执行的代码部分。
五、网络
网络面板可以帮助开发者监控网页上所有网络请求的情况,包括资源加载时间、HTTP状态码、请求头和响应头等信息。通过分析网络请求,开发者可以找出性能瓶颈,了解哪些资源加载缓慢,从而优化网站的加载速度和用户体验。
六、性能
性能面板提供了一系列工具,用于分析网页的渲染性能和性能瓶颈。开发者可以通过录制页面的交互过程,观察各种性能指标,如帧率、交互响应时间等。这对于提升页面性能和优化用户体验至关重要。
七、安全性
随着网络安全问题日益受到重视,谷歌浏览器的开发者工具也提供了安全性面板,以帮助开发者检测网页的安全性。开发者可以查看网页的SSL证书信息、混合内容警告等,确保其网站符合安全标准。
八、移动设备模拟
开发者工具还附带了一个强大的移动设备模拟功能。通过点击“Toggle Device Toolbar”按钮,开发者可以模拟不同设备和屏幕尺寸,检查网页在不同设备上的显示效果。这对于响应式设计的测试尤为重要,可以帮助开发者确保网站在各种设备上的兼容性和可用性。
结论
谷歌浏览器的开发者模式是一个强大而灵活的工具,对于前端开发者而言,掌握其中的各种功能能够大大提高工作效率。通过善用这些工具,开发者不仅可以方便地调试和优化网页,还可以不断提升自己的技术水平。在快速发展的互联网环境中,只有不断学习和实践,才能更好地应对各种挑战,创造出优质的网络应用。